About C. Lindsay

C. Lindsay Anderson is Professor and Chair of the Department of Biological and Environmental Engineering at Cornell University. She holds a B.Sc. in Environmental Engineering and an M.Sc. in Environmental Engineering from the University of Guelph in 1994 and 1998, respectively, and a Ph.D. in Applied Mathematics from Western University in 2004. Anderson began her academic career as Assistant Professor in Civil and Environmental Engineering at Western University from 2004 to 2006. At Cornell, she served as Senior Research Associate and Adjunct Assistant Professor from 2006 to 2012, Assistant Professor from 2012 to 2017, Associate Professor from 2017 to 2022, and Professor and Department Chair since 2023. She has held additional appointments including Interim Director of the Cornell Energy Systems Institute from 2020 to 2023, House Professor-Dean of William T. Keeton House since 2021, Kathy Dwyer Marble and Curt Marble Faculty Director for Energy at the Cornell Atkinson Center for Sustainability from 2018 to 2021, and Senior Fellow at the Cornell Atkinson Center for Sustainability.

Her research advances energy system decarbonization at the intersection of environmental and systems engineering, electric power systems, optimization, and decision science. Notable awards include the Energy Systems Integration Group Award of Excellence for Contributions to Energy Systems Optimization in 2021, IEEE Senior Member since 2019, Cornell College of Engineering Award for Research Excellence in 2016, NSF CAREER Award in 2015, Norman R. Scott Sesquicentennial Faculty Fellowship in Energy Systems Engineering in 2012, and Cecil Graham Doctoral Dissertation Award in 2004. Key publications comprise "Evaluating the intensity, duration and frequency of flexible energy resources needed in a zero-emission, hydropower reliant power system" (Doering et al., 2022, Oxford Open Energy), "An open source representation for the nys electric grid to support power grid and market transition studies" (Liu et al., 2022, IEEE Transactions on Power Systems), "A new wavelet denoising method for selecting decomposition levels and noise thresholds" (Srivastava et al., 2016, IEEE Access), and "Secure planning and operations of systems with stochastic sources, energy storage, and active demand" (Murillo-Sánchez et al., 2013, IEEE Transactions on Smart Grid). She contributes to the New York Independent System Operator’s environmental advisory committee and co-led the Electric Energy Systems track at the Hawaii International Conference on System Sciences.
